10. Definite articles (in English, the) are used with
nouns to indicate specific persons, places, or
things. Indefinite articles (a, an) are used with
nouns to indicate nonspecific persons, places, or
things.
Examples:
The boy is a friend. The (El) definite article
El chico es un amigo. a (un) indefinite article

12. English Grammar Connection. Adjectives are words that
describe nouns. In English, the adjective almost always
comes before the noun. In Spanish, the adjective usually
comes after the noun.
Examples:
The serious students.
Los estudiantes serios.

13. Noun – Adjective Agreement
In Spanish, adjectives match the gender and
number of the nouns they describe.
Masculine
Singular el chico alto the tall boy
Plural los chicos altos the tall boys
Feminine
Singular la chica alta the tall girl
Plural las chicas altas the tall girls

14. To make a negative statement about
yourself, all you have to do is place the word
“no” before the verb ser in the sentence.
For example, if you want to say “I am not tall”
you would say: Yo no soy alta.
You may also see sentences where the
subject pronoun is dropped. This is okay to
do once you feel more comfortable with
using the verb.
Ex: Soy alto- I am tall (the yo is dropped)
